We’re the people who Care About Care
Care About Care is a grassroots movement bringing together people who work in care, people using social care services, their families and loved ones, organisations that provide social care, and communities across the country to advocate for meaningful reform of the social care system in England.
In short, it’s a movement for everyone who cares about our communities, cares about our country having a bright future, and cares about building a care system that is there for us all.
Established in response to a growing number of people not being able to access the care they need, Care About Care aims to champion the voices of people working in and relying on care, ensuring they are heard clearly by Government.
Our movement represents a broad coalition, and is funded by individuals, organisations that work in the social care sector, charities, and people with lived experience of the system – reflecting the diversity, scale, and importance of social care across the country.
While Care About Care is run by an independent campaign team, the initial idea came from Providers Unite, with initial funding generously donated by the National Care Association (NCA).
